Jogging around Lauter-Bernsbach offers access to a diverse landscape within the Erzgebirge district of Germany. The region features dense forests, rolling hills, and scenic river valleys, including the Lauter and Zwickauer Mulde rivers. A well-developed network of trails, many with mostly paved surfaces, provides suitable options for running. The area is characterized by its natural setting, with elevations ranging from river valleys to the Spiegelwald plateau.

Best jogging routes around Lauter-Bernsbach

  • The most popular jogging route is Erzengelweg loop from Lauter-Bernsbach, a 6.8 miles (10.9 km) trail that takes 1 hour 12 minutes to complete. This moderate route features a steady elevation gain through the local landscape.
  • Another top favourite among local runners is Old Locomotive – Bärenrundweg Bernsbach loop from Grünhain-Beierfeld, a moderate 4.2 miles (6.7 km) path. This trail ascends from the Schwarzwassertal towards the Spiegelwald, featuring wooden sculptures.
  • Local runners also love the König Albert Tower (Spiegelwald) – View Over the Fields loop from Bernsbach, a 4.8 miles (7.8 km) trail leading through the Spiegelwald, often completed in about 50 minutes. This route offers views from the König-Albert-Turm.

What are some notable landmarks or viewpoints I can see while running in Lauter-Bernsbach?

The region is rich in natural beauty and landmarks. You can enjoy magnificent views from Bernsbach and Oberpfannenstiel, often called the “Balcony of the Erzgebirge.” The König Albert Tower (Spiegelwald) – View Over the Fields loop from Bernsbach offers panoramic vistas from the König-Albert-Turm. Other routes, like the Old Locomotive – Bärenrundweg Bernsbach loop from Grünhain-Beierfeld, feature unique wooden sculptures along the way. You might also encounter the Blauenthal Waterfall or the Devil's Stones on trails in the wider area.

Are there any circular running trails in Lauter-Bernsbach?

Absolutely! Many running routes in Lauter-Bernsbach are circular, offering convenient starting and ending points. Popular options include the Erzengelweg loop from Lauter-Bernsbach, the Bärenrundweg Bernsbach loop, and the König Albert Tower (Spiegelwald) loop. The region also features the Erzgebirgs-Kammweg, a manageable 4.4 km circular route, and the Vugelbeer-Rundweg, approximately 16 kilometers long.

Are there any routes that lead to the Spiegelwald (Mirror Forest)?

Yes, the Spiegelwald is a prominent forested area, and several routes lead to or through it. The König Albert Tower (Spiegelwald) – View Over the Fields loop from Bernsbach is a great option that takes you through the Spiegelwald and offers views from the König-Albert-Turm. The Bärenrundweg also ascends towards the Spiegelwald, providing a varied running experience.

How long are the running routes in Lauter-Bernsbach typically?

The running routes in Lauter-Bernsbach vary significantly in length to suit different preferences. You can find shorter loops, such as the Erzgebirgs-Kammweg at approximately 4.4 kilometers, up to longer trails like the Vugelbeer-Rundweg at around 16 kilometers. Many popular routes, like the Erzengelweg loop, are around 10-11 kilometers, offering a good balance for a moderate run.
